On average across the year,
no, Armenia is not hotter than
New Haven, Connecticut
.
Armenia has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F and New Haven, Connecticut has an average temperature of 12°C/54°F.
Armenia's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F, which is approximately the same temperature as New Haven, Connecticut's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).
On average across the year, yes, Armenia is colder than New Haven, Connecticut . Armenia has an average minimum temperature of 4°C/39°F and New Haven, Connecticut has an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F.
On average across the year,
no, Armenia has less rain than
New Haven, Connecticut. Armenia has an average annual rainfall of 916mm and New Haven, Connecticut has an average annual rainfall of 1269mm.
Armenia's wettest month is March, with an average monthly rainfall of 110mm, which is drier than New Haven, Connecticut's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 126mm).
